// Fixture: export-retry-smoke.json
// Covers the Larchfield export pipeline's retry path: we simulate two
// transient upstream failures, then a success on attempt three. Release
// managers: if this fixture starts flaking, check the backoff jitter
// config first — it's bitten us twice. The mock export gateway here
// enforces auth just like prod, so the harness attaches the standard
// test credential on every retry. That credential is the bearer token below.

session JWT of yawep-yawep = eyJhbGciOiJIUzI1NiIsInR5cCI6IkpXVCJ9.eyJzdWIiOiI3pWF3_In0.aXYsHiog

Subject: SQL lint cut-over — done!

Hey,

Good news: the cut-over to the new Quillcheck SQL linting rules went through last night without drama. All repos under the Fernvale platform now get linted on push — trailing semicolons, uppercase keywords, the whole ruleset we argued about. Two legacy repos are grandfathered until next sprint, so don't be alarmed if their pipelines skip the step. Everything else is enforced. For your records, the linter is running with the following configuration values.

settings of tagef-bawif:
DRUIX_HOST=druix.zemvarlabs.internal
DRUIX_PORT=8000

### Pagination Release Check — Wrenfield API

Before promoting a build of the Wrenfield public API, confirm that cursor-based pagination returns stable ordering across all list endpoints. Run the contract tests twice to rule out flakiness. Once tests pass, the release bundle must be signed before upload to the gateway. Use the signing key below.

signing key of bagap-yawep = bky13_TbfT6ZMUoGJo2

- [ ] **Step 7: Breaker override escrow.** After sealing the signing keys for the Tallgrove upstream API circuit breaker, confirm the support team can force the breaker open during a full outage. The override bundle lives in the sealed escrow drawer and is useless without its unlock phrase. Two ceremony witnesses must initial this step before proceeding. The escrow bundle is decrypted with the recovery passphrase that follows.

vault phrase of kahip-kahop = holath-quenmir